Renew in micro-zones.
Fractional laser treats the skin in thousands of tiny micro-zones, leaving surrounding tissue intact so it heals quickly while stimulating strong collagen remodeling. It improves acne scars, texture, pores and tone over a series. Ablative and non-ablative options trade more downtime for stronger results, so a dermatologist matches the type and energy to your scars and skin tone — important for darker skin to avoid pigment change. Downtime is usually a few days of redness and flaking.
